Last of The GW Free Rules Have Been Paywalled

Age-of-sigmar-3.0-wal-hor-title-rulesIt’s a sad time for AoS players as the last of free rules from GW have been paywalled behind the newest Beta app.

The old AoS app was one of the best digital products GW had ever come out with. Honestly, it was easy to use, fast, and had every army in there. Now, the new app is going the way of the 40k one. Where you only have access to the battletomes that you pay for. At least unlike with the 40k app, they are legit being upfront that it is a beta offering,

However, you could also make the argument that they should have waited to cut off the old app that 100% worked till this was ready to go.

The old armies are still free in the new app, but every time they release a new book (i.e. Stormcast and Orruks) you will need to purchase the book to get access.

You could make the case that the core rules are still free from Games Workshop for both systems, however, you will still need the General’s Handbook, or Chapter Approved to play a matched play game.

They also are taking down the free rules on the GW website to force more people towards the app. This all just means no more free rules. Plus, if the 40k app is anything to go on, AoS players have a lot to go through if the app is anything like the futuristic version.

AoS paywalledThis pic comes from Reddit, and guess what it shows? That Stormcast is already paywalled! So every time an army comes out, you will need the digital code from the physical book to get anything but the warscrolls.
